A 14-year-old person of interest is believed to be responsible for the fatal shooting of a 16-year-old girl in a Morrisania schoolyard.
Police Commissioner Jessica Tisch says it happened around 5 p.m. when a group of students exiting Bronx Latin High School got into a fight.
She says one of the students pulled out a gun and fired at least three shots. At least one of those shots struck a 16-year-old girl in the head.
Police say the 16-year-old is not a student at Bronx Latin. She attended neighboring Morris High School.
Police say she was not engaged in the fight.
"We know that we have an obligation to create safe environments for young people and that is what we try to do every day," said Mayor Eric Adams.
"She should be home right now eating dinner with her family, instead we are talking about another child victim of gun violence," said Tisch.
Police say the 14-year-old person of interest is not yet in custody.
